I am currently working on a redstone project on a realm, and got very frustrated when creepers spawned in the redstone. Most of the redstone was completely destroyed, and so I looked for dark spots to stop any future spawns. When I couldn't find any, I downloaded a copy of the realm to fly through in spectator, and found no dark spots that would have allowed the creeper to get to that area. I have also had zombies go after the villagers in that area, but there again is no dark areas. The area I am working on is underground, closed off to any outside spawns. While I was assessing the damage, I had more mobs crawl out of areas all light level 7 or higher. I am very frustrated and don't know of any other solution other than to stop playing until this is fixed.

If you are only using redstone for lighting, there could be times when there is no light, particularly if there is a lot of lag. It can also be helpful to use other lighting sources around large redstone projects to reduce those lighting updates and the consequent lag that comes with them.
I do have other forms of light in the area, the redstone lamps simply raise the light level at times. The whole area never drops below light level 5, even when all the lamps are off.
